**Your Purpose as a Title Specialist**:

- Prepare all new and used motor vehicle title paperwork for the state in which they will be titled
- Submit legal title transfer work to the WI Department of Motor Vehicles using the online system through DealerTrack Registration & Title
- Follow up with various lenders on the title status of recently paid off vehicles/trade-ins
- Work with DMV and lenders to resolve title issues
- Verify the accuracy of all paperwork and ensure that all information is complete
- Flips trade in titles to the dealer’s name
- Compiles and maintains a complete list of all outstanding title work, including a missing title list. Reports to management on the status of any missing or problem titles
- Processes monthly title audit
- Other duties as assigned by management

**Baxter Auto Group**

Baxter Auto Group is one of the nation's leading automotive retail groups, serving the communities of Omaha and Lincoln, Nebraska; Kansas City, Kansas; Colorado Springs, Colorado; and Madison, Wisconsin. The company operates 21 dealerships and represents nine of the nation's top automotive brands, including Ford, Lexus, Toyota, Audi, Volkswagen, Honda, Subaru, Mercedes-Benz, and Infiniti.
